Let Babylon Burn is created by Robert Lancaster from Norway.
Blending acoustic roots, reggae, soul, blues, and emotionally driven storytelling, the project has rapidly grown into a global independent breakout — generating over 120 million YouTube plays, 61+ million Spotify streams, and millions of listeners worldwide.
Major chart placements include:
• #1 Spotify Viral 50 Germany
• #1 Netherlands
• #1 Switzerland
• #2 Sweden
• #2 France
• #2 Norway
The project has also gained strong traction across Apple Music, TIDAL, Shazam, Amazon Music, and iTunes.
Known for raw emotional delivery and cinematic atmosphere, the music explores themes of loss, redemption, love, survival, and personal transformation.

THE MAN BEHIND LET BABYLON BURN
For a long time I let the music speak for itself.
That was intentional.
Lately I've seen more and more people calling Let Babylon Burn "AI slop."
If that's your opinion, you're entitled to it.
But before you reduce years of work to two words, here's the truth.
Yes, I use AI.
No, I don't depend on it.
My process has always been mix of ai and me.
The ideas, the stories, the emotions, the lyrics, the direction, the countless rewrites, the production decisions... that's me.
AI is a tool.
Just like a camera doesn't make someone a photographer, and Photoshop doesn't make someone an artist.
The person behind the tool still matters.
For years I worked as a first responder in the ambulance service.
I've seen people take their first breath.
I've watched others take their last.
I've comforted families on the worst day of their lives.
I've witnessed addiction, heartbreak, violence, courage, sacrifice, and hope.
You don't walk away from twenty years of that unchanged.
Those experiences became my songs.
Not because I wanted to be famous.
Not because I wanted money.
Because after twenty years of trying to save lives with an ambulance, I found another way to reach people.
Music.
If you've ever found comfort in one of my songs...
If you've cried...
If you've decided to keep fighting because of a lyric...
Then that's worth more to me than any chart position or royalty statement.
People also ask why I stayed anonymous.
Simple.
The name Let Babylon Burn says enough.
It challenges people.
It questions things.
And over the last year I've received death threats, attempts to intimidate me, and more hatred than I ever imagined music could generate.
I'm Norwegian.
People who know Norway know how open public records are.
Finding someone's name or address isn't exactly difficult if that's your goal.
The difference is...
I don't live my life looking over my shoulder.
I'm not going to hide because anonymous people on the internet think fear should win.
So...
This is me.
Not because I owe anyone an explanation.
But because I wanted to thank the people who believed in the music before they knew the face.
